From fab4d7d62b2039ab8660649d26a8c6f8f32193b5 Mon Sep 17 00:00:00 2001 From: riku <risaku@163.com> Date: 星期四, 11 一月 2024 17:41:11 +0800 Subject: [PATCH] 1. 初步完成评估任务整体逻辑; 2. 新增评估记录下载功能(待完善) --- src/views/fysp/evaluation/DataSource.vue | 26 ++++++++++---------------- 1 files changed, 10 insertions(+), 16 deletions(-) diff --git a/src/views/fysp/evaluation/DataSource.vue b/src/views/fysp/evaluation/DataSource.vue index c680dec..aac4e87 100644 --- a/src/views/fysp/evaluation/DataSource.vue +++ b/src/views/fysp/evaluation/DataSource.vue @@ -1,33 +1,27 @@ <template> <el-row :gutter="16"> <el-col :span="16"> - <CompPreCheck></CompPreCheck> + <CompPreCheck @start-task="refreshTask"></CompPreCheck> </el-col> <el-col :span="8"> - <el-card shadow="never" class="radius"> - <template #header> - <el-row justify="space-between"> - <div> - <div><el-text tag="b" size="large">鑷姩璇勪及浠诲姟</el-text></div> - <el-text size="small" type="info">鏄剧ず褰撳墠姝e湪杩涜鐨勮嚜鍔ㄨ瘎浼颁换鍔$姸鎬�</el-text> - </div> - <el-button icon="Refresh" type="primary" size="default" :loading="loading" @click="submit" - >鍒锋柊浠诲姟</el-button - > - </el-row> - </template> - </el-card> + <CompEvaTask ref="refEvaTask"></CompEvaTask> </el-col> </el-row> </template> <script> -import CompPreCheck from './components/CompPreCheck.vue'; +import CompEvaTask from './components/CompEvaTask.vue'; +import CompPreCheck from './components/precheck/CompPreCheck.vue'; export default { name: 'DataSource', - components: { CompPreCheck }, + components: { CompPreCheck, CompEvaTask }, data() { return {}; + }, + methods:{ + refreshTask(){ + this.$refs.refEvaTask.fetchTask() + } } }; </script> -- Gitblit v1.9.3